原文:AQS源碼分析看這一篇就夠了

好了,我們來開始今天的內容,首先我們來看下AQS是什么,全稱是 AbstractQueuedSynchronizer 翻譯過來就是 抽象隊列同步 對吧。通過名字我們也能看出這是個抽象類 而且里面定義了很多的方法 里面這么多方法,咱們當然不是一個個去翻。里面還有很多的抽象方法,咱們還得找它的實現多麻煩對不對。所以我們換個方式來探索。 場景模擬 我們先來看下這樣一個場景 在這里我們有一個能被多個線程 ...

2021-08-23 14:22 0 258 推薦指數:

查看詳情

ShardingSphere 看這一篇夠了

1、什么是shardingSphere ​ Apache ShardingSphere 是一套開源的分布式數據庫中間件解決方案組成的生態圈,它由 JDBC、Proxy 和 Sidecar(規划中)這 ...

Sun Jul 04 08:02:00 CST 2021 1 1255
關於Kaggle入門,看這一篇夠了

這次醞釀了很久想給大家講一些關於Kaggle那點兒事,幫助對數據科學(Data Science)有興趣的同學們更好的了解這個項目,最好能親身參與進來,體會一下學校所學的東西和想要解決一個實際的問題所需 ...

Thu May 09 19:16:00 CST 2019 0 1439
@Override 看這一篇夠了

一、是什么 一句話:它是表示重寫的注解 @Override注解是偽代碼,用於表示被標注的方法是一個重寫方法。 不寫也完全可以,但強烈建議寫上! 二、為什么用 既然不寫@Override ...

Sat May 25 02:06:00 CST 2019 0 3389
java 鎖,看這一篇夠了

Java 鎖分類 Java 中的鎖有很多,可以按照不同的功能、種類進行分類,下面是我對 Java 中一些常用鎖的分類,包括一些基本的概述 從線程是否需要對資源加鎖可以分為 ...

Sat Jan 04 23:59:00 CST 2020 1 1001
Java NIO?看這一篇夠了

現在使用NIO的場景越來越多,很多網上的技術框架或多或少的使用NIO技術,譬如Tomcat,Jetty。學習和掌握NIO技術已經不是一個JAVA攻城獅的加分技能,而是一個必備技能。在前面2文章《什么是Zero-Copy?》和《NIO相關基礎》中我們學習了NIO的相關理論知識,而在本篇中我們一起 ...

Fri Sep 06 20:26:00 CST 2019 0 539
ActiveMq 之JMS 看這一篇夠了

什么是JMS MQ 全稱:Java MessageService 中文:Java 消息服務。 JMS 是 Java 的一套 API 標准,最初的目的是為了使應用程序能夠訪問現有的 MOM 系 統( ...

Sun Jul 11 18:46:00 CST 2021 0 176
什么是BFC?看這一篇夠了

BFC 定義 BFC(Block formatting context)直譯為"塊級格式化上下文"。它是一個獨立的渲染區域,只有Block-level box參與, 它規定了內部的Block- ...

Wed Aug 19 23:00:00 CST 2020 0 495
學習反射看這一篇夠了

.katex { display: block; text-align: center; white-space: nowrap; } .katex-display > .katex > .kate ...

Fri Dec 13 04:39:00 CST 2019 3 329
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M